What fencing material is best for Hoboken's environment?
Material compatibility is critical. With moderate soil corrosivity, all metal components must be hot-dip galvanized. Use stainless ste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ks. Given the moderate termite risk, pressure-treated wood or composite materials are required; untreated pine is not a viable long-term option.
Is my fence designed for Hoboken's wind loads?
All designs are engineered for the 115 MPH V-ult wind speed rating. This dictates maximum post spacing, concrete footing mass, and the required bracket strength (ASCE 7-22 standards). A non-engineered fence will likely fail during peak storm season gusts, especially in exposed areas.

Will my fence posts be stable in Hoboken's soil?
Stability requires posts set below the 42-inch frost line. Post footings above this line in Downtown Hoboken will lift from frost heave, causing permanent failure. The 2021 IRC requires this depth, and we engineer our footings to exceed it, ensuring long-term alignment and structural integrity.
What preparation is needed before installation?
You must call New Jersey 811 for a utility locate at least three business days before digging. Striking an unmarked line in Downtown Hoboken incurs major liability and repair costs. How high can I build my fence in Hoboken?
Zoning limits are 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ards, with a 0-foot setback permitted. For corner lots, especially near NJ-495, you must maintain a clear 'sight triangle' for traffic visibility. The City will not issue a permit for a design that obstructs this critical safety zone.
